Transaction 17bb046ef32c7d75c578e8f0a28fe67e68433595e5e5db92456916c23aecd07b
1 Input
1 Output
-
17bb046ef32c7d75c578e8f0a28fe67e68433595e5e5db92456916c23aecd07b:0
- value
- 67739
- script pubkey
- OP_0 OP_PUSHBYTES_20 76ec158952e670ad2ad871efde3be68afe81b6b0
- address
- bc1qwmkptz2juec262kcw8hauwlx3tlgrd4sg5t3su